How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Chestnut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Chestnut Hill Pet Friendly Studio Apartments | $2,367 | $1,400 | $5,906 |
| Chestnut Hill Pet Friendly 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,784 | $800 | $7,223 |
| Chestnut Hill Pet Friendly 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,557 | $1,350 | $10,000+ |
| Chestnut Hill Pet Friendly 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,998 | $1,033 | $10,000+ |
| Chestnut Hill Pet Friendly 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,538 | $1,300 | $9,900 |
| Chestnut Hill 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,500 | $1,450 | $10,000+ |
| Chestnut Hill 6 Bedroom Apartments | $7,364 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|
